Description Chris Lieb 2008-12-02 21:12:28 UTC
Bugzilla was released on 29 Nov, but I have not seen an ebuild for it in the tree or in the sunrise, Mozilla, Perl, or webapps overlays.  I have decided to give a go at modifying the ebuild for bugzilla-3.0.5 to make it work for 3.2.  The only things that I changed were some of the dependencies since 3.2 wants newer versions of some deps, and also adds a dep or two.  The only optional dependency that I could not find was RadiusPerl.

Here is a diff of the 3.0.5 ebuild to the 3.2 ebuild:

This is the ebuild created from the diff in the bug description.  I have tested it and it appears to work.  The only caveat at the time is that I do not include the RadiusPerl module as a dependency.
Comment 2 Chris Lieb 2008-12-02 21:15:22 UTC
One more note: the files can be satisfied by copying files/3.0 to files/3.2.  I don't see any reason to update any of the extra files.
Comment 3 Chris Lieb 2008-12-03 17:04:08 UTC
One note: I had to restart Apache (using mod_perl) before Bugzilla would work after the upgrade, in addition to running checksetup.pl.

Other than that, Bugzilla seems to run just fine from this ebuild.
